ABSTRACT
Objective:To investigate the relationship between the expression of vascular endothelial growth factor-C(VEGF-C) proteins and biological behavior of breast cancer.Methods:Immunohistochemical staining was used to detect the expression of VEGF-C proteins in 12 cases of mammary fibroma,35 cases of mammary cystic hyperplasia,45 cases of breast cancer.Results:VEGF-C protein was absent in mammary fibroma,the expression rate of VEGF-C protein in mammary cystic hyperplasia was 20.0%(7/35),The expression rate of VEGF-C in breast cancer was 71.1%(32/45),and it was significantly different compared with mammary cystic hyperplasia(P
